首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

易语言如何连接本地mysql数据库

易语言是一种面向中文编程的开发语言,可以方便地连接本地MySQL数据库进行数据操作。

要连接本地MySQL数据库,首先需要安装并配置好MySQL数据库。然后,可以使用易语言提供的相关函数和库来连接数据库。下面是一个示例代码,用于连接本地MySQL数据库:

代码语言:txt
复制
库文件 "Win_Mysql.dll"
类型
    MYSQL_DBCONN_DEF = 自定义结构
        szHost AS char *  '数据库服务器IP地址'
        szUser AS char *  '用户名'
        szPassword AS char *  '密码'
        szDatabase AS char *  '数据库名称'
    end 自定义结构

    MYSQL_STMT_DEF = 自定义结构
        conn AS MYSQL_DBCONN_DEF  '数据库连接'
        szSql AS char *  'SQL语句'
        hResult AS handle  '查询结果句柄'
        nRowCount AS int  '查询结果行数'
    end 自定义结构
变量
    Conn AS MYSQL_DBCONN_DEF
    Stmt AS MYSQL_STMT_DEF

    // 初始化数据库连接参数
    Conn.szHost = "localhost"
    Conn.szUser = "root"
    Conn.szPassword = "123456"
    Conn.szDatabase = "mydatabase"

    // 连接数据库
    Call Mysql_Connect(Conn)

    // 执行SQL查询
    Stmt.conn = Conn
    Stmt.szSql = "SELECT * FROM mytable"
    Call Mysql_Query(Stmt)

    // 获取查询结果
    Stmt.hResult = Mysql_GetResult(Stmt)
    Stmt.nRowCount = Mysql_NumRows(Stmt.hResult)

    // 遍历查询结果
    For i = 0 To Stmt.nRowCount - 1
        Mysql_DataSeek(Stmt.hResult, i)
        // 获取每一行的数据并进行处理
        // ...

    // 关闭数据库连接
    Call Mysql_Close(Conn)

以上示例代码中,通过调用Mysql_Connect函数来连接本地MySQL数据库,并使用Mysql_Query函数执行SQL查询。然后,使用Mysql_GetResultMysql_NumRows函数获取查询结果,并使用Mysql_DataSeek函数遍历每一行的数据。

需要注意的是,以上示例只是简单介绍了连接本地MySQL数据库的基本步骤,实际应用中可能还需要进行错误处理、数据处理等其他操作。

腾讯云提供了云数据库 MySQL 产品,可以在云端部署、管理和使用MySQL数据库。通过使用腾讯云云数据库 MySQL,可以方便地实现数据库的高可用、自动备份、监控等功能。详情请参考腾讯云云数据库 MySQL的官方文档:云数据库 MySQL

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

9分52秒

【玩转腾讯云】如何通过公网代理连接MySQL

15.9K
7分59秒

如何用ChatGPT模拟MySQL数据库

47分20秒

突破物理机规格瓶颈,云数据库 MySQL 如何又稳又灵活?

59分17秒

如何省心、省力、省钱搭建MySQL数据库——中小企业优雅之选

8分10秒

day13【前台】搭建环境/12-尚硅谷-尚筹网-会员系统-搭建环境-MySQL工程-连接数据库

1分10秒

MySQL数据库LRU链表是一个动态的效果,会不断地有页加入,也不断有页被淘汰,那大致是如何计算冷热

37分5秒

jdbc操作数据库从0到1保姆级教程

35分54秒

尚硅谷-28-SQL92与99语法如何实现内连接和外连接

2分15秒

01-登录不同管理视图

17分49秒

MySQL教程-02-MySQL的安装与配置

12分7秒

MySQL教程-04-DB DBMS SQL的关系

11分6秒

MySQL教程-06-对SQL语句的分类

领券